Топ 10 причини да научите Python
Езиците за програмиране съществуват от векове и на всяко десетилетие се появява нов език, който сваля разработчиците от крака.Python се счита за един от най-популярните и търсени езици за програмиране. Неотдавнашно проучване на Stack Overflow показа, че Python е завладял езици като Java, C, C ++ и е стигнал до върха. Това прави един от най-търсените сертификати за програмиране.Чрез този блог ще изброяТоп 10 причини да научите Python.
Пригответе се да се влюбите в Python !!
По-долу са изброени основните функции и приложения, поради които хората избират Python като първия си език за програмиране:
- Популярността и високата заплата на Python
- Python се използва в Data Science
- Скриптове и автоматизация на Python
- Python, използван с големи данни
- Python поддържа тестване
- Компютърна графика в Python
- Python, използван в изкуствения интелект
- Python в уеб разработката
- Python е преносим и разтегателен
- Python е лесен и лесен за научаване
Ако планирате да започнете кариерата си в Python и искате да знаете умения свързано с него, сега е подходящият момент да се потопите, когато технологията е в ново зараждане.
Топ 10 причини да научите Python | Научете програмиране на Python | Едурека
Сега, позволете ми да ви помогна да ги разберете по-подробно.
10. Лесно и лесно за научаване
Така че под номер 10 Python е изключителнолесен и лесен за научаване. Това е много мощен език и много наподобява английския език!
И така, какво допринася за неговата простота? Python е
моят урок за SQL за начинаещи
- Безплатен и с отворен код
- Високо ниво
- Интерпретиран
- Благословен с голяма общност
Освен това в Python не е нужно да се справяте със сложен синтаксис, можете да се обърнете към изображението по-долу:
Ако трябва да отпечатате „здравей свят“, трябва да напишете над три реда, докато в Python е достатъчен само един ред, за да отпечатате „здравей свят“. Просто SIMPLE момчета!
Така че 10-тата причина се крие в простотата на кода, който прави най-добрия костюм за начинаещи.
9. Преносим и разтегателен
Преносимите и разширяеми свойства на Python ви позволяват да извършвате безпроблемно междуезични операции. Python се поддържа от повечето платформи, присъстващи в индустрията днес, вариращи от Windows до Linux до Macintosh, Solaris, Play station, наред с други.
Windows добавя java към пътя
Функциите за разширяемост на Python ви позволяват да интегрирате Java, както и .NET компоненти. Можете също да извикате библиотеки C и C ++.
8. Уеб разработка
Python има набор от рамки за разработване на уеб сайтове.Популярните рамки са Django, Flask, Pylons и др.Тъй като тези рамки са написани на Python, това е основната причинакоето прави кода много по-бърз и стабилен.
Можете също така да извършите изрязване на уеб, където можете да извлечете подробности от други уебсайтове. Ще бъдете впечатлени, тъй като много уебсайтове като Instagram, bit bucket, Pinterest са изградени само на тези рамки.
7. Изкуствен интелект
AI е следващото огромно развитие в технологичния свят. Всъщност можете да накарате машина да имитира човешкия мозък, който има силата да мисли, анализира и взема решения.
Освен това библиотеки като Трудно и TensorFlow включете функционалността на машинното обучение в комбинацията. Това даваспособност за учене без изрично програмиране.Освен това имаме библиотеки като openCv това помагакомпютърно зрение или разпознаване на изображения.
6. Компютърна графика
Python се използва до голяма степен в малки, големи, онлайн или офлайн проекти. Използва се за изграждане на GUI и настолни приложения.Използва „ Tkinter ‘Библиотека за осигуряване на бърз и лесен начин за създаване на приложения.
Използва се и при разработване на игри, където можете да напишете логиката на използването на модул „ пигма който също работи на устройства с Android.
5. Рамка за тестване
Python е чудесен за валидиране на идеи или продукти за утвърдени компании.Python има много вградени рамки за тестване, които обхващат отстраняването на грешки и най-бързите работни потоци.Има много инструменти и модули за улесняване на нещата, като например Селен и Сплинтър .
Той поддържа тестване с различни платформи и различни браузъри с рамки като PyTest и Робот Рамка.Тестването е досадна задача, а Python е ускорител за него, така че всеки тестер определено трябва да се справи!
4. Големи данни
Python се справя с много главоболия с данни. Той поддържа паралелни изчисления wтук можете да използвате Python за Hadoop както добре. В Python имате библиотека, наречена „ Pydoop ” и можете да напишете a MapReduce програма в Python и обработва данни, присъстващи в HDFS клъстера.
Има и други библиотеки като „ Dask ' и ' Писпарк 'за обработка на големи данни.Следователно, Python се използва широко за големи данни, където можете лесно да го обработвате!
3. Скриптове и автоматизация
Много хора знаят само, че Python е език за програмиране, но Python може да се използва и като скриптов език. При скриптове:
- Кодът е написан под формата на скриптове и се изпълнява
- Машината чете и интерпретира кода
- Проверката на грешки се извършва по време на изпълнение
След като кодът е проверен, той може да се използва няколко пъти.Така че чрез автоматизация можете да автоматизирате определени задачи в програма.
2. Наука за данните
Python е водещият език на много специалисти по данни.За години, академични учени и частни изследователи използваха езика MATLAB за научни изследвания, но всичко товазапочна да се променя с пускането на числови двигатели на Python като „ Numpy ’ и ' Панда .
е a и има връзка в Java
Python също се занимава с таблични, матрични, както и със статистически данни и дори ги визуализира с популярни библиотеки като „ Matplotlib ’ и ' Seaborn ‘.
1. Популярност и висока заплата на Python
Инженерите на Python имат едни от най-високите заплати в бранша.Средната заплата за разработчици на Python в САЩ е приблизително $ 116 028 на година .
Също така, Python има силен скок в популярността през последната 1 година. Вижте скрийншота по-долу, взет от Google Trends.
Надявам се, че моят блог на тема „Топ 10 причини да научите Python“ е бил подходящ за вас. За да получите задълбочени познания за Python заедно с различните му приложения, разгледайте нашия интерактивен онлайн на живо тук това идва с поддръжка 24 * 7, която да ви води през целия период на обучение.